如何快速掌握一个行业?100个关键词就够了,跟我来一起学习吧:一天一个关键词-AIGC-100天
Scaling Law(缩放法则)是机器学习和人工智能领域中一个重要的概念,它描述了模型大小、数据集大小和训练过程中使用的计算资源量增加时,模型性能如何改变的定量规律。这一概念对于指导大规模模型的设计和训练具有重要的意义。
Scaling Law的核心原理
Scaling Law基于幂律关系描述了模型性能随模型规模的增长而改变的规律。这意味着,随着模型参数的增加、数据集的扩大和更多的计算资源的投入,模型的性能会按照一定的幂律规律提高。重要的是,这种性能提升并非无限制的;当模型大小、数据集大小或计算资源达到一定程度后,性能提升的速度会逐渐放缓,最终趋于一个上限。
Scaling Law的实践意义
在实际应用中,理解和应用Scaling Law可以帮助研究人员和工程师更有效地分配资源,优化模型设计,从而达到期望的性能目标。例如,通过Scaling Law,可以预测在当前数据集大小下,增加模型大小或计算资源的投入是否能够带来显著的性能提升,或者在资源有限的情况下,如何平衡模型大小、数据量和计算资源的配置,以获得最佳性能。
Scaling Law的限制
尽管Scaling Law提供了一个强大的工具来预测模型性能的改变趋势,但它也有其局限性。例如,Scaling Law可能无法准确预测所有类型模型或任务的性能变化,特别是当模型或数据集具有特定结构或属性时。此外,实际应用中还需考虑计算成本、能耗和模型部署的实际限制。
应用实例
OpenAI的GPT系列模型是应用Scaling Law的一个著名例子。通过系统地增加模型的规模,GPT系列模型在多个任务上实现了显著的性能提升。这一系列工作不仅展示了Scaling Law在实践中的应用,也推动了整个AI领域对于大规模模型训练的研究和投资。
结论
Scaling Law是理解和设计大规模机器学习模型的关键概念。它提供了一个框架,帮助研究人员和工程师预测模型性能随模型规模变化的趋势,并指导他们如何有效地利用有限的资源。尽管有其局限性,但Scaling Law的原理和应用对于推动AI技术的发展具有重要意义。随着机器学习领域的不断进步,我们期待出现更多的研究成果来扩展和精细化对Scaling Law的理解,进一步优化大规模模型的设计和训练过程。